Tell the Success Story of Charlie Chaplin
Charlie Chaplin's success was due to his unique comedic talent. His iconic character, the Tramp, with the bowler hat, cane, and oversized shoes, was instantly recognizable. His physical comedy was brilliant. He could convey complex emotions like sadness and hope through simple gestures. Chaplin's movies were also a social commentary. He tackled issues like poverty and the struggles of the working class, which made his work not only entertaining but also thought - provoking. This combination of factors led to his great success.

The Real Hollywood Story of Charlie Chaplin
Charlie Chaplin was a true icon in Hollywood. He was known for his unique style of physical comedy. His character, the Tramp, was instantly recognizable with his bowler hat, cane, and big shoes. Chaplin's films often had a strong social message. For example, 'Modern Times' was a commentary on the industrial age and how it affected the common man. His work was highly influential and inspired many future comedians and filmmakers.
